Hey, I have a set of short pipes that are WAY TOO LOUD. The pipes have one baffle in them now, but that is clearly not enough to subdue the deafening noise these guys make. The one baffle in the pipe sits about 4 inches in from the slip-on point, and about 4-5 inches from the slash-cut tip (total 8-9 inches of play). If I moved the existing baffle forward to the slip-on point, leaving 8-9 inches for another baffle in the rear, would this affect the way the engine runs, or heat builds up? I'd like to keep them, but I want a controlled rumble, not a screaming, neighbors hate you, rumble. If I could fit 2 baffles in these short pipes, would that work? suggestions?
